I just started something in our home. We dont go to Disney for another 2.5 months and there's some behaviors we want to try to correct with DD 5.

So, I found some download-able play-money (1's, 5's, 10's) here:
http://freestuff4kids.net/2007/02/12/printable-play-money/

Then I painted out the person in the center and replaced them with disney/pixar characters. Told DD that in addition to saving her allowance (she gets a quarter every Wednesday for setting the table, hehehe), that she can earn these Disney dollars.

I printed 20x $1, 3x $5, and 1x $10. I put her favorites like Cinderella and Tinkerbell on the $5's....i put the castle on the $10. I explained to her that to earn the $5's and $10 she's gonna have to do some really impressive stuff...but then she can spend that money on ANYTHING she wants when we go.

She earned her first $1 on Friday by trying Sushi, which we've been trying to get her to do for a couple months. She now LOVES salmon sashimi, and is $1 Disney dollar richer.

we're doing something similar with my two older ones. (9 & almost 4). they made the "dollars" themselves with disney stickers and stamps. we have a calendar and they get stars for morning and afternoon. at the end of the week they get a certain number of dollars depending on how many stars they have. they each have a cute wallet i bought to keep them in. before our trip i plan to let them trade them in for real "disney dollars" that they can have for spending money.

it has actually been working rather well. they havent had a week yet that they havent received the full amount. good luck!
